LOS ANGELES, CALIFORNIA: Legendary actress, Joan Collins, has shared her thoughts on the transformation of Hollywood, expressing her belief that the industry has lost its sparkle due to modern-day cancel culture. Known for her illustrious career and collaborations with some of the biggest names in film and television, the 'Dynasty' star now laments the changing landscape of star-studded parties and the industry as a whole. 

In an interview, Collins claimed, “The parties I go to now are kind of… dull. They are red carpet things in which everybody does behave. If you don’t behave now you are going to get cancelled.” The 90-year-old actress then proceeded to praise a select few stars, “I think Nicole Kidman is fabulous and Margot Robbie is one of the great beauties. Particularly Brad, he is like one of the movie stars of the Golden Age,” reported New York Post.

Collins has never shied away from sharing her opinions on the state of the entertainment industry. In a previous interview with The New York Times in March 2022, she touched on the impact of the #MeToo movement on attitudes toward men in Hollywood. Concerned about the rise of "anti-maleness," Collins emphasized her belief in gender equality while appreciating the unique strengths of both men and women

“Sadly, I think that now young men are suffering from being labeled toxically masculine because of this rise of anti-maleness,” Collins told the outlet. “I believe that women are equal to men in every single way,” she added. “Except physical strength. People say you didn’t burn your bra, you wear lipstick. So what? I’m very proud of being a woman.”

Collins touched on society’s use of gender-neutral terms saying, “What’s wrong with mother? What’s wrong with woman? Girl? I don’t like having that word taken away,” she said at the time. Despite the changing landscape of Hollywood, Collins has maintained a steadfast stance regarding her appearance. Contrary to many stars who undergo cosmetic procedures, she proudly stated that she "has not had any 'work' done". She admitted to trying Botox once, adding she “screamed and left the surgery.”
